This week Bill takes us to more parks in Northeastern Ontario, he’s headed towards the City of Greater Sudbury and its three nearby provincial parks and some other honourable mentions as he completes this series of five stories

The summer is going by too quickly, a daily vehicle permit is a great way to explore a provincial park for the day; bike, hike, swim, picnic and make some magical outdoor memories and explore nearby communities.

“The meteorite created one of Canada’s most significant mining regions. Miners have been extracting nickel and other minerals for over a hundred years. Some signs of that activity can be seen along the park’s hiking trail. The trail also provides excellent views of Fairbank Lake from high above,” he added.It has a great sandy beach for swimming and building sand castles, a volleyball court and the lake is perfect for watersports like canoeing .

Windy Lake Provincial Park sits on the edge of the Sudbury Basin, a huge meteorite crater nearly 2 billion years old. The drive from Sudbury up to Windy Lake passes through the Onaping River Valley, a rugged and scenic route that is actually part of the rim of the crater. volleyball court, its own outhouse and a very large picnic shelter – this makes a great location for those large family gatherings like reunions.Halfway Lake Provincial Park may be one of the Sudbury region’s hidden gems. It is a great day trip for anyone from families to adventurers, to nature lovers. It has great hiking trails. It has an Earth, Wind and Fire theme as there have been recent forest fires and tornado ravaging parts of this park.

Two kilometres, south of Cartier, which is south of Halfway is one of the largest roadside erratics on the east side of the highway, there is a safe pull-off area here for photos.There is a smattering of other parks to mention in this series of five stories. Don’t forget Chutes Provincial Park in Massey, just off of Highway 17.

Helenbar Lookout Trail - 7 km of moderate difficulty. Focal points include huge boulder erratics, a spectacular lookout and views of the surrounding mountainous landscape. There is a white sand beach on Semiwite Lake where the Helenbar and Semiwite Lake Trails meet. It is worth the hike.North of the Sault is Batchawawa, a day-use park only with one of the longest sand beaches on Lake Superior. A must-see and do when travelling Highway 17.

The trail to the falls is a 2-km round trip and easy to follow. You cross over a small bridge over the gorge and follow the rest of the trail to the viewing areas. It is a hidden gem that showcases Aubrey’s seven different waterfall chutes.
